Baked Macaroni Cups

Idge Mendiola
Looking for a fun bonding activity with the kids? Have them help you prepare their afternoon merienda.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Course Main Dishes
Cuisine American
Servings 12 cups

Ingredients
  

Baked Macaroni Cups

  • Butter for greasing
  • 200 Grams macaroni noodles
  • 2 pieces cheese hotdog
  • 1 Pack spaghetti sauce
  • 1/4 Cup quick- melting cheese
  • Salt

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 375°F and grease a regular 12-cup muffin tray with butter. Cook macaroni according to package directions; drain and set aside. Fry the  cheese hotdogs and slice into rounds.
  • Mix cooked macaroni, hotdog slices, and Hunt’s Parmesan Cheese Spaghetti Sauce in a bowl. Season with salt and pepper.
  • Scoop mixture into prepared muffin cups and top with quick-melting cheese.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 10 to 15 minutes until tops are golden. Let cool for a few minutes before serving.
